east119 发表于 2018-3-3 12:08:24

easypoi一点也不easy

本帖最后由 east119 于 2018-3-3 13:06 编辑

模版下载后的excel,添加数据后再导入进去的时候数字字段后面都会给加'.0',我在entity里明明已经设置为字符串类型的,

导出数据后的excel,再修改数字字段,导入时候就没有问题,

对比发现,模版excel的单元格格式是常规,修改成文本也不行,数字字段都会给加'.0',

而导出数据excel的单元格格式已经给转换成以文本形式存储的数字,所以数字字段不会给加'.0',

问题 1、entity里已经设置为字符串类型,为什么数字之后还会加'.0'?
       2、下载模版时候单元格给自动转换成以文本形式存储的数字格式,easypoi如何设置单元格格式?
       3、字典表字段在导出时显示的是字典text,导入时必须写字典code吗?不能写字典text自动转换成字典code吗?


fly1206 发表于 2018-3-5 17:42:02

数字类型的字段,可以使用easypoi 的 convert 格式化处理下返回String类型就行了

east119 发表于 2018-3-5 21:09:09

谢谢回答第3个问题怎么解决 导入时字典text能转字典code吗?
页: [1]
查看完整版本: easypoi一点也不easy